Wild Earth Central Otago Chardonnay 2018

"Gorgeously fruited and instantly appealing, the bouquet shows ripe peach, rockmelon, vanilla, cedar and brioche characters. The palate is equally satisfying with excellent fruit weight and intensity, wonderfully supported by creamy mouthfeel and well-balanced acidity. Flavoursome and highly enjoyable. At its best: now to 2023" Sam Kim, Wine Orbit, Apr 2019

"Soft, light, delicate chardonnay with subtle toast, hazelnut, stone fruit, nectarine, spice and anise flavours supported by an ethereal texture. An accessible wine that is a pleasure to drink now" Bob Campbell, Master of Wine, Real Review, Mar 2019

"Toasty, fruity and ripe with aromas of vanilla and smoky oak, yellow stone fruits, some popcorn and nutty burnt butter scents. Gentle creamy texture precede flavors of oak and stone fruit. Contrasting acidity, fine wood tannins, lovely core of flavour and finish. Drink now and through 2023" Cameron Douglas, Master Sommelier

"This extroverted but ageworthy wine was grown at Pisa and Bendigo - districts of the Cromwell Basin – and fermented with indigenous yeasts in French oak casks (15% new). Fragrant and full-bodied, it has strong, vibrant, peachy flavours, slightly toasty and creamy notes adding complexity, and fresh acidity. Already highly approachable, it should be at its best 2021+" Winestate Magazine

This elegant cool climate Chardonnay is exquisitely detailed with great length and a mineral finish. The 2018 vintage shows beautiful flinty notes with bright citrus and crunchy stone fruit on the nose. The palate is long and fine with layers of citrus and a hint of positive lees influence complimented by freshness from the apt acidity. While the new oak has minimal influence on the palate it contributes greatly to the wine’s extra-long finish. A fantastic wine to drink on its own but also great with fish, seafood and cuisine with lots of zest!

The Chardonnay grapes come from two sites in the Cromwell basin: a slightly elevated site in Pisa that retains great acidity and a prestigious vineyard in Bendigo. The 2017-18 growing season was the hottest on record overall with November and January breaking records for heat and an unusual amount of days over 30 degrees Celsius in Summer. February was the wettest on record which helped in a positive way to slow down the onset of harvest although it was still a month early and very compact. These Chardonnay grapes were hand harvested over three distinct picks between the 10th-15th March. The dry harvest period kept the grapes disease free and in great balance.

The wine was fermented with wild yeasts on full solids which adds both richness and complexity to the wine. Each vineyard included just one new barrel (15% new oak) from the premium Troncais forest in France; the rest was fermented in older French oak. Minimal stirring and full malolactic fermentation gives the wine a balance of creamy texture and great drive.
